Members 1st Credit Union Share Certificate Review

Members 1st Credit Union Share Certificate are offered by Members 1st Credit Union, a credit union founded in 1936 and based in Redding, CA. Members 1st Credit Union Share Certificate are available in 1 state.

Key Takeaways

  • Only one share certificate type available. Members 1st Credit Union Share Certificate only offers traditional share certificate accounts.
  • Low APY. The maximum annual percentage yield for this account is only 0.7%.
  • $1,000 minimum deposit. This is a typical minimum initial deposit for the certificates we track.
  • Wide selection of certificate terms. Members 1st Credit Union Share Certificate allows you to create a certificate ladder by spreading your cash across certificates with different terms. This combines the benefits of frequent access to funds and higher rates of return on your savings.

Are share certificates from Members 1st Credit Union federally insured?

Yes, your share certificates are insured up to $250,000 per share owner for each account ownership category. The National Credit Union Administration (NCUA), a federal agency, administers the insurance fund and regulates federally insured credit unions. The fund is backed by the full faith and credit of the U.S. Government.

What is the difference between CDs and Share Certificates?

Certificates of Deposit (CDs) and Share Certificates are both deposit accounts where your money can grow at a fixed rate for a predetermined period of time. Both are low-risk and federally insured products designed to give you a better rate on your deposits than typical savings accounts. The main difference between them is that CDs are offered by for-profit banks, whereas Share Certificates are offered by member-owned, not-for-profit credit unions.

What is the grace period for Members 1st Credit Union Share Certificate?

There is a 10-day grace period for Members 1st Credit Union Share Certificate. A grace period is a period of time during which you can withdraw the money in your share certificate without paying an early withdrawal penalty. A grace period starts the day after a share certificate’s maturity date, or the final day a share certificate is opened. Standard share certificates renew automatically at the same term if you don't withdraw your money after the 10-day grace period. Note that the new share certificate rates probably won’t be the same as the original.
